Look Out: Gap Stock Has Room To Run
Published: February 10, 2025 by: Seeking Alpha
Sentiment: Positive
Gap has shown a 52% total return over the last three years. Despite revenue declines, Gap's recent quarters show year-over-year growth, with a notable increase in online sales and improved operating margins. Gap's stock remains undervalued, with forward P/E and EV/EBITDA near 2-year lows.

The Gap Remains An Apparel Brand Icon, Which Could Benefit From Strong U.S. Consumer Spending
Published: February 10, 2025 by: Seeking Alpha
Sentiment: Positive
I recommend a buy rating on The Gap stock as it could see tailwind from 2024 holiday sales results but also a strong 2025 economy driving consumer spend on apparel. The key upsides are a strong profit margin, proven cashflow generation, declining leverage risk, and an undervalued share price. Its Athleta brand has already seen a surge in demand in FY24, and could benefit from market growth in the athletic leisurewear space.
